Biography

Thomas Paris is researcher at CNRS (GREG HEC) and associate professor at HEC Paris. He is the scientific director for the MS MAC (Media, Art & Creation). 

His research are in the field of the creative industries (movie and TV, music, fashion, book, architecture, advertising, high cooking, industrial design...). He studies these industries both on the creation management and on the economical and regulatory viewpoints. He also works on innovation management and organizational learning, in partnership with big companies and start-ups.
